Output 51a334c872f0332a605943aa717cc945304382d603833392ecd16f382c1274a6:0

value
17627
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ca95d9203d8c8b0d13a28b90bf5e1d88f743a1d8 OP_EQUALVERIFY OP_CHECKSIG
address
1KUB1P8jfTS4uFmXs5Xsk9ivFDk5Hq5Z7t
transaction
51a334c872f0332a605943aa717cc945304382d603833392ecd16f382c1274a6
spent
true